American Fiction

X135A (3 semester units in English)

In reading classic works by authors such as Twain, Poe, Crane, Melville, Wharton, Hawthorne, London, and others, you survey the major American novelists and short-story writers of the nineteenth and early twentieth century. You learn about various literary movements such as romanticism, realism, and naturalism and are encouraged to consider questions of aesthetics, morality, poverty, racism, gender, and power.
